Jordi Artigas Esclusa is a leading researcher in the field of space robotics, with a primary focus on teleoperation and haptic feedback systems for orbital and planetary missions. His major contributions center on the development of shared control architectures that synergize visual servoing with force-feedback telepresence, enabling more intuitive and effective remote manipulation of robots in challenging environments. Notably, his work on the KONTUR-2 experiment, which implemented force-feedback teleoperation of ground-based robots from the International Space Station, represents a significant achievement in demonstrating the feasibility of real-time haptic control from orbit. This breakthrough enhances the safety and precision of tasks such as on-orbit servicing and satellite maintenance.
